Output cedda75c97700a65004ef4a0b8c592f2a16a86ba54cc74555c2c2e26a8a85e5a:180

value
63288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e89a7ca4beb06de2875354fa8d4423f6cb174e OP_EQUAL
address
3Bz2FboLphLjMJhL6SZQsxHcYAvQ5E2KBe
transaction
cedda75c97700a65004ef4a0b8c592f2a16a86ba54cc74555c2c2e26a8a85e5a
spent
true